Detailed problem analysis
- What you bought: a Wi‑Fi smart plug is a relay in a plug‑in adapter that switches mains power to whatever you plug into it. The relay is controlled via your home Wi‑Fi through a mobile app (sometimes also via Bluetooth during onboarding).
- Typical electrical ratings (US): 120 V AC, 10 A or 15 A max (resistive). Some include energy metering; some support only on/off.
- Load considerations:
- Resistive loads (lamps with incandescent bulbs, toasters) are easiest.
- Inductive/motor loads (fans, pumps, fridges) draw high inrush current; even a “10 A” motor can trip or weld a small relay. Use a plug explicitly rated for motor/inductive loads if you must control these.
- Heaters/ACs: check nameplate. For continuous loads (3+ hours), target ≤80% of both the device rating and branch‑circuit rating (e.g., on a 15 A circuit, keep continuous load ≤12 A).
- Onboarding modes you may encounter:
- EZ/Bluetooth mode: the app sees the plug automatically while the LED blinks quickly.
- AP mode: the plug exposes a temporary Wi‑Fi hotspot; you join it, then provide your home SSID and password.
- Network prerequisites:
- 2.4 GHz SSID enabled (many plugs do not support 5 GHz).
- WPA2 or WPA2/WPA3 mixed security; “WPA3‑only” networks can fail.
- If your router combines 2.4/5 GHz under one SSID and setup keeps failing, temporarily separate the bands or move farther from the router so your phone prefers 2.4 GHz.

Supporting explanations and details
- Universal setup (generic Tuya/Smart Life, Kasa, eWeLink style):
- Plug it in; confirm the LED is blinking (pairing). If not, hold the button 5–10 s until it blinks rapidly.
- Install the app named in the manual (examples: Smart Life/Tuya, Kasa, eWeLink, Wyze, Tapo, Geeni). Create/login to an account.
- Ensure your phone is on your 2.4 GHz Wi‑Fi. Disable VPN and cellular data during onboarding if the app suggests it.
- In the app: Add Device → Plug/Outlet → follow prompts. If “EZ” fails, choose “AP/Compatibility Mode”; join the plug’s temporary Wi‑Fi when asked, then return to the app.
- Name the device (“Living‑room lamp”) and assign a room.
- Test: plug in a small lamp; toggle in‑app and with the physical button.
- Voice assistants:
- Alexa: in the Alexa app, Skills & Games → enable the plug’s skill (or add the Matter device), link accounts, discover devices.
- Google Assistant: Google Home app → add device → Works with Google (or scan Matter code).
- App features you’ll likely find:
- On/off, Schedules, Sunrise/Sunset automations, Countdown timer.
- Energy monitoring (if hardware supports it): instant W, daily kWh, cost estimates.
- Away/Randomize mode for lights.
- Device sharing with family accounts.
- OTA firmware updates—apply these for security and stability.
- Reliability tips:
- Keep RSSI strong: avoid metal enclosures and place within good Wi‑Fi coverage.
- Give your plug a DHCP reservation so its IP doesn’t change (helps local control).
- If it drops offline, power‑cycle, then router reboot. As a last resort, delete and re‑add via AP mode.
Ethical and legal aspects
- Safety/compliance:
- Use only on loads within the printed rating. Look for UL or ETL listing marks for US use. Outdoor plugs must be outdoor‑rated (NEMA 3R or better) and used in weather‑resistant receptacles with in‑use covers.
- Avoid daisy‑chaining (e.g., smart plug → power strip → space heater). Do not control life‑safety or medical devices.
- Bathrooms, kitchens, garages, and outdoor locations should be protected by GFCI; many bedrooms/living areas use AFCI—ensure your plug’s load won’t nuisance‑trip these.
- Privacy:
- Cloud‑connected plugs may collect usage and network metadata. Use strong, unique credentials; enable 2FA where offered. Consider Matter/local‑control devices to reduce cloud reliance.
Practical guidelines
- Quick start (5‑minute checklist):
- Confirm rating and load.
- Phone on 2.4 GHz; VPN off.
- Plug in → hold button 5–10 s until fast blink.
- Add in app (try EZ, then AP if needed).
- Name, assign room, run a test schedule.
- Best practices:
- Start with a low‑power lamp for validation.
- Create a “Fail‑safe” schedule (e.g., off at 1:00 AM) to prevent devices being left on.
- Label the plug with its name to match the app.
- For multiple plugs, use consistent naming (Room‑Function, e.g., “Office‑Printer”).
- Common pitfalls and fixes:
- Stuck on 5 GHz: separate SSIDs or use a 2.4‑only guest network for onboarding.
- WPA3‑only router: switch to WPA2/WPA3 mixed temporarily.
- Hidden SSID: unhide during setup; some devices won’t join hidden networks.
- LED patterns unclear: slow blink often = AP mode; fast blink = EZ mode.
Possible disclaimers or additional notes
- Not all plugs support energy monitoring or high‑inrush loads; relays are consumables with finite cycle life.
- Hardwired “smart receptacles” exist; if yours replaces a wall outlet, have a licensed electrician install it and follow local code.
